A super cool and rare coloured pale blue/grey background on this antique Ushak carpet from Anatolia (Turkey). Woven around 1890-1900 we can see the large scale geometric floral designs which make Ushaks desirable and famous today with collectors and interior designers to furnish homes with. Large leaf designs and bold medallions on this all over pattern, which make it very easy to place in any room. The border is deep and rich red with famous orange, purple and sludgy green dyes used frequently in Ushak carpets from this period.

The wool pile is thick and high throughout and woven on a woollen foundation this is a loose weave that is typical with rugs from this region. The palette of dyes and design can make you feel this is a contemporary carpet woven recently! when in fact dating at around 120 years old it is remarkable they wove rugs which have stood the test of time, and these timeless colours are used today for interiors.
